Setting up protection against IT attacks in the enterprise using Zyxel equipment

A typical IoT attack looks like this: the device connects to a malicious Internet resource directly or through its own VPN, downloads and installs malicious code on itself, after which it begins to be either part of a large bot farm for attacks on third-party resources and use as a resident proxy, or simply spies on your network, trying to intercept anythat data, pull information from open resources or harm in any other way. ZyWALL ATP 800 - testing the performance of the top security gateway from Zyxel

If you have not previously met with Zyxel ATP, then here is a brief brief for you: this powerful 8-core Multi-WAN gateway combines all modern methods of analysis, protection of privacy and integrity of your corporate network: signature lists of Internet sites and IP addresses, intrusion prevention system (IDP), antivirus and HTTPs sniffer for both Web and mail, plus a Wi-Fi controller with proprietary Secure Wi-Fi technology that installs a VPN tunnel directly to the access point. NetGear SRX5308: Gigabit UTM for small offices

The NetGear SRX5308 firewall is designed for companies that require the speed of communication channels. Four WAN ports support two session-level load balancing modes, as well as switching for increased reliability. Support for up to 125 VPN tunnels or up to 50 tunnels when using SSL. Support for VLAN, extended ACL, 4 WAN and 4 LAN, and all this - at a price of about $ 550, that is, we are dealing with a new price range that is available to all customers.
